Understanding the Psychology of High-Ceiling Clinical Spaces

The Cathedral Effect is a psychological theory that suggests high-ceiling environments promote abstract thinking and a sense of mental freedom while low ceilings encourage detail-oriented focus. In a clinical context, this means that the physical environment directly influences the patient’s cognitive and emotional state before a procedure even begins.

The Science of the Cathedral Effect in Patient Care

The science of the Cathedral Effect is a fascinating psychological phenomenon that explains how vertical volume impacts human cognition and emotion. Studies in environmental psychology suggest that ceilings significantly higher than the standard can stimulate the right hemisphere of the brain, promoting abstract thought and a sense of psychological freedom. In a clinical setting like LUNN, this translates to a reduction in the white coat syndrome often experienced by patients. When the ceiling is elevated, the perceived density of the room decreases, which helps to mitigate the claustrophobic stress typical of standard medical offices. Patients in high-ceiling environments often report a significant increase in perceived comfort compared to those in standard 2.4-meter rooms.
